Hollywood, 60s. The star of a western television, Rick Dalton, tries to adapt to the changes of the medium at the same time as his double. Dalton's life is completely linked to Hollywood, and he is a neighbor of the promising young actress and model Sharon Tate who has just married the prestigious director Roman Polanski.



Quentin Tarantino

Quentin was born in Knoxville, Tenessee, in 1963. He spent his youth in a suburb of Los Angeles and became interested in film at an early age. His passion led him, at the age of 22, to work in a video store where he spent his days with his friend Roger Avary, with whom he wrote 'Pulp Fiction' several years later. It's during this time that he decided to edit his first scripts. Owing to the sale of his scripts 'True Romance' and 'Natural Born Killers', he directed his first film 'Reservoir Dogs' in 1992. The film was widely distributed and became one of the best cop thrillers of the 90s. His second film, 'Pulp Fiction' won the Palme d'Or at the 1995 Festival de Cannes. In 1997, he shot 'Jackie Brown', one of the best films of the decade, a tribute film to American cinema of the 70s. Following an absence of five years, Quentin was back on the studio lot in 2002 with 'Kill Bill'. Originally produced as a single film, it was finally released in two parts: 'Kill Bill Volume 1' and 'Kill Bill Volume 2'. 'Death Proof', 'Inglorious Basterds' and the recent 'Django Unchained" were his following projects.
